27 June 2023

Choosing the Right Software for Your Startup: A Comprehensive Guide

Starting a new business is an exciting venture filled with many important decisions. One of the most crucial choices you'll need to make is selecting the right software.

It's not an easy task, given the multitude of options available and the implications this decision can have on your business operations. But don't worry; this comprehensive guide is here to assist you in making an informed decision.

Understanding Your Needs

Before you can select the appropriate software, you must first understand your business needs. Every startup is unique, and the software that works for one may not be suitable for another. Start by outlining your business processes and identify areas that would benefit from automation or simplification. This will help you form a clear picture of what you need your software to do.

Budget Considerations

We understand that as a startup, budget is likely to be a significant constraint. However, when it comes to choosing software, it's essential to strike a balance between cost and quality. While it might be tempting to opt for the cheapest option, consider the potential long-term cost savings of investing in the right software. The right software can increase efficiency, reduce errors, and even drive revenue - making it well worth the investment.


Scalability refers to the ability of your software to grow with your business. As your startup evolves, you'll want software that can adapt to your changing needs. Whether that means handling more data, accommodating more users, or incorporating additional features, scalability is a crucial factor to consider when choosing your software.


In an increasingly digital world, security is of paramount importance. This is especially true if your business handles sensitive customer data. When evaluating software options, be sure to scrutinize their security features. Look for software that adheres to best practices in data security and offers robust protections against potential threats.

Ease of Use and Support

User-friendly software is essential for ensuring your team can hit the ground running. Complicated interfaces can lead to a steep learning curve and decreased productivity. Additionally, strong customer support can make a world of difference when you encounter problems or need help understanding certain features. You can evaluate these factors by taking advantage of free trials and reading user reviews.

Exploring Different Types of Software

There are several types of software that your startup might need. Project management tools can help keep your team organized and on track. Customer Relationship Management (CRM) software can streamline your sales process and improve customer communication. Accounting software can simplify financial management and ensure you stay compliant. Understanding what each type of software does can guide you towards making the right choice for your startup.

Choosing the right software for your startup is a significant decision that can greatly impact your business's success. It might seem daunting, but by understanding your needs, considering your budget, and evaluating different software options, you can make an informed choice. Remember, the goal is not just to choose software, but to choose the software that will best support your startup's growth and success.

Remember, these are big decisions, and it's okay to take your time. After all, the software you choose will be instrumental in shaping your startup's journey. Good luck, and here's to your success!

